What is the term hydrological cycle?
HelpCenter Definition. The water cycle — technically known as the hydrological cycle — is the continuous circulation of water within the Earth’s hydrosphere and is driven by solar radiation. This includes the atmosphere land surface water and groundwater.

What holds 96.5 of Earth’s water?
About 71 percent of the Earth’s surface is water-covered and the oceans hold about 96.5 percent of all Earth’s water. Water also exists in the air as water vapor in rivers and lakes in icecaps and glaciers in the ground as soil moisture and in aquifers and even in you and your dog.

What is meant by the term hydrosphere?
Powered by
A hydrosphere is the total amount of water on a planet. The hydrosphere includes water that is on the surface of the planet underground and in the air. A planet’s hydrosphere can be liquid vapor or ice. On Earth liquid water exists on the surface in the form of oceans lakes and rivers.
What is meant by the term condensing in science?
Condensation is the process where water vapor becomes liquid. It is the reverse of evaporation where liquid water becomes a vapor. Condensation happens one of two ways: Either the air is cooled to its dew point or it becomes so saturated with water vapor that it cannot hold any more water.

What is it called when plants release water that turns into vapor?
Overall this uptake of water at the roots transport of water through plant tissues and release of vapor by leaves is known as transpiration. Water also evaporates directly into the atmosphere from soil in the vicinity of the plant. … In general evapotranspiration is the sum of evaporation and transpiration.

What is the term for water that moves across the surface of the land and enters streams and rivers?
Runoff. When precipitation reaches the earth’s surface some of it will flow along the surface of the land and enter surface water like lakes streams and rivers as runoff. The rest of it soaks or percolates into the soil called recharge.

How much percent water is drinkable in the world?
70% of the earth is covered in water yet only 3% of it is fresh. Of that 3% 2.6 of it is locked away in glaciers and polar ice caps. That leaves us with 0.4% of the earth’s water in the form of rivers and underground aquifers to try to utilize for our consumption and societal development.
